Islanders win over Boston in ELmont

In Elmont, New York Islanders’ Semyon Varlamov made 40 saves on Thursday night in a 3-1 win over the Boston Bruins.
The Isles lead, 3-0 until Mike Reilly damaging the bid ends with a strike when 54 seconds are left on the clock.
New York improved to 8-12-5.
Islands’ Cal Clutterbuck hit for a pair of targets.
The Bruins drop to 14-10-2.
Anthony Beauvillier there is a unique marker for Islanders. It was his first goal in 15 games.
Clutterbuck won by a goal into an empty net with less than three minutes to go.
The Bruins were short substitutes for the game, with 17 skaters. Seven Bruins players are using the NHL’s COVID19 protocol for the past three days.
Linus Ullmark made 25 saves. in the loss in Boston.
